package org.neo4j.driver.internal.util;
import java.util.ArrayList;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import java.util.Objects;
import static java.util.Collections.emptyList;
import static java.util.Collections.emptyMap;
public class QueryKeys
{
private static final QueryKeys EMPTY = new QueryKeys( emptyList(), emptyMap() );
private final List keys;
private final Map keyIndex;
public QueryKeys( int size )
{
this( new ArrayList<>( size ), new HashMap<>( size ) );
}
public QueryKeys( List keys )
{
this.keys = keys;
Map keyIndex = new HashMap<>( keys.size() );
int i = 0;
for ( String key : keys )
{
keyIndex.put( key, i++ );
}
this.keyIndex = keyIndex;
}
public QueryKeys( List keys, Map keyIndex )
{
this.keys = keys;
this.keyIndex = keyIndex;
}
public void add( String key )
{
int index = keys.size();
keys.add( key );
keyIndex.put( key, index );
}
public List keys()
{
return keys;
}
public Map keyIndex()
{
return keyIndex;
}
public static QueryKeys empty()
{
return EMPTY;
}
public int indexOf( String key )
{
return keyIndex.getOrDefault( key, -1 );
}
public boolean contains( String key )
{
return keyIndex.containsKey( key );
}
@Override
public boolean equals( Object o )
{
if ( this == o )
{
return true;
}
if ( o == null || getClass() != o.getClass() )
{
return false;
}
QueryKeys queryKeys = (QueryKeys) o;
return keys.equals( queryKeys.keys ) && keyIndex.equals( queryKeys.keyIndex );
}
@Override
public int hashCode()
{
return Objects.hash( keys, keyIndex );
}
}
